About the product:
There are really lots of products from Math Mammoth. No matter what your elementary child's needs are, I'm betting that Math Mammoth can help! Whether it's a full curriculum, or just some needed review in one or two areas, Math Mammoth has it. Do you like downloads or CD's? Math Mammoth has both. Prefer a hard copy? Many of their products are available in book form. And best of all, their prices a great! For example, I checked out a download for Addition and Subraction practice, and it was only $4.00! That was for a 75 page book out of which 57 were actually work pages. Then I checked out the first grade full curriculum. There are two books, A and B, which cost only $14 each. That's only $28 for a whole year of math. The author, Maria Miller, a former college math instructor, has made it her goal to make math instruction reasonably priced for everyone!
Here's a breakdown from the website that explains the different products available:
The BLUE SERIES are worktexts with explanations in between the problems. In other words, the 'text' and the 'work' (=problems) alternate. These are perfect for those parents who have a weak math background. Also, with the worktexts one lesson spans several pages instead of just one page.
The GOLDEN SERIES are grade level collections of worksheets: just one-page worksheets without any explanations. They are just math problems, like you'd find in a math book, one topic per page, especially designed for teachers - or parents - who wish to have worksheets to give for homework or to work at class, but who will provide the explanations and teaching themselves.
The GREEN SERIES are collections of worksheets by topic. They are one-page worksheets without any explanations, but concentrating on one topic per book. The books contain worksheets of various difficulty across several grade levels. These are perfect for teachers again.
The LIGHTBLUE SERIES is a complete math curriculum, currently available for grades 1, 2, 3, and 4. Each grade contains two worktexts, answer keys, and tests.
What are the pros of this product? There are LOTS of pros! First of all, you can download everything, so no shipping, and no waiting for the mail man. (OK, I know, sometimes it's fun to wait for a package, but it' also fun to get stuff right away!) Anyway, imagine your child is new to the concept and makes several mistakes. You can simply print out a new page and start all over. Plus, you can use the same books for your next child. Very cost effective. If you prefer to use CD's, you can order it that way. (For me, I avoid CD's as we always end up scratching them.) And if you are "old school" and simply must have a book, you can order it that way too.
Another pro is that you can order just practice sheets, practice sheets with explainations, books that cover one topic, or books that cover a whole year's worth of material. The prices are great, and if you buy more than one product you can sometimes bundle things to save even more.
